Chevron Corporation (NYSE: CVX) ended Wednesday’s session almost unchanged as crude prices remained elevated amid ongoing disruption around the Strait of Hormuz. Investors are weighing the immediate benefits of higher oil prices against the longer-term possibility that Gulf producers could increasingly rely on alternative export routes.
Chevron shares slipped just 0.03%, while Brent crude settled at $88.98 a barrel and West Texas Intermediate ended at $83.27. The muted move in CVX reflects a market caught between tight near-term oil supplies and expectations that new infrastructure could eventually reduce the geopolitical premium attached to crude.
Gulf Routes Could Reshape Oil Flows
The Strait of Hormuz remains a critical passage for global energy markets, but Gulf producers are accelerating efforts to develop alternative routes. Projects under discussion could add approximately 3.8 million barrels per day of bypass capacity by the end of 2027.
That figure could rise to around 7.3 million barrels per day by the end of 2028. Against a prewar Gulf export base of roughly 23 million barrels per day, the additional capacity would represent nearly one-third of those exports.
When combined with existing alternative routes, total potential bypass capacity could eventually reach about 13.8 million barrels per day, equivalent to roughly 60% of the region’s previous export volume.
For oil investors, the significance extends beyond current supply. Greater access to alternative routes could make future disruptions less damaging to global crude flows. That could gradually weaken the risk premium that has helped support oil prices during the present crisis.
Hormuz Traffic Remains Severely Disrupted
The infrastructure being planned does little to solve the immediate transportation bottleneck. Shipping activity through Hormuz remains far below normal levels.
Kpler recorded only eight Hormuz transits on Tuesday, compared with a prewar daily range of 125 to 140 vessels. That places current activity roughly 94% below the midpoint of the previous range. LSEG recorded 11 transits, down from 14 the previous day.
The sharp decline in traffic continues to raise concerns over the movement of crude and other energy products. However, weaker demand expectations could offset some of the upward pressure on prices.
OPEC has lowered its forecast for 2026 oil-demand growth to 580,000 barrels per day, while the International Energy Agency expects demand to contract by 1.6 million barrels per day.
That creates a mixed environment for Chevron. Sustained supply disruptions could support crude prices and upstream earnings, but weaker global consumption could eventually limit the benefit.
Chevron Enters Disruption Strongly
Chevron‘s latest financial performance gives the company a strong starting point as the energy market deals with the disruption.
The oil major reported $12 billion in adjusted second-quarter earnings, sharply higher than the $3.1 billion recorded a year earlier. Worldwide production also climbed 20% to 4.07 million barrels of oil equivalent per day.
U.S. output increased 23% to 2.08 million barrels of oil equivalent per day. Operating cash flow rose to $22.6 billion from $8.6 billion, while free cash flow jumped to $18.1 billion from $4.9 billion.
Those figures demonstrate how quickly Chevron can generate cash when production is strong and oil prices remain supportive. The company’s geographic exposure also provides some protection because its Middle Eastern production is smaller than that of several major competitors.
